Vincent R Murden 1949 - 1992

Vincent R Murden was born on November 19, 1949, and died at age 42 years old on February 29, 1992. Vincent Murden was buried at Calverton National Cemetery Section 67 Site 1714 210 Princeton Boulevard - Rt 25, in Calverton, Ny. Did you know?
In 1949, in the year that Vincent R Murden was born, comedian Milton Berle hosted the first telethon show. It raised $1,100,000 for cancer research and lasted 16 hours. The next day, newspapers, in writing about the event, first used the word "telethon."
